Output 3d84bc9c19ebf203ebb39cd0907baecf7ac9b351a8f60e4941c9dd209d2df4d4:1

value
5791511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b69609b08c462174b104682d48fab79b57c10dbf OP_EQUAL
address
3JLSeGan8EskM3Lk4gK2tS23YBFNm19ZGy
transaction
3d84bc9c19ebf203ebb39cd0907baecf7ac9b351a8f60e4941c9dd209d2df4d4
confirmations
206209
spent
true